Ernesto Soberon said that the decision will take effect on July 1.

In response to the criteria of Cuban residents abroad, Cuba’s Foreign Ministry on Tuesday announced measures that include the extension of passport validity, the elimination of its extensions, and the reduction of its cost.

A memorandum of understanding was signed between Cuba and Vietnam entities.

Cuba and Vietnam agreed to strengthen cooperation in the field of veterinary medicine, on the occasion of the visit of Deputy Minister Maury Hechavarría at the head of a delegation of the Ministry of Agriculture (MINAG).
